Crawlspace waterproofing services are designed to prevent water intrusion and manage moisture levels beneath a building. These services typically involve installing barriers such as vapor barriers or waterproof membranes to block water from seeping into the crawlspace. Additionally, contractors may incorporate drainage systems, sump pumps, or dehumidifiers to control humidity and remove accumulated water. Proper waterproofing helps maintain a dry environment, reducing the risk of structural damage and mold growth within the space.
Water infiltration in crawlspaces can lead to numerous issues, including wood rot, mold development, and increased indoor humidity. Excess moisture often attracts pests and can cause deterioration of building materials over time. By addressing these problems early through waterproofing, property owners can protect their investment and improve indoor air quality. Properly waterproofed crawlspaces also help prevent the formation of musty odors that can affect the living areas above.

The overview below groups typical Crawlspace Waterproofing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Carleton, MI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Basic Waterproofing - The typical cost for basic crawlspace waterproofing ranges from $1,500 to $3,500. This usually includes sealing cracks and installing a vapor barrier to prevent moisture intrusion.
Drainage System Installation - Installing a drainage system in a crawlspace can cost between $2,000 and $5,000. The price varies based on the size of the area and the complexity of the system needed.
Encapsulation Services - Full encapsulation of a crawlspace often costs between $4,000 and $15,000. This service involves sealing the entire area with a moisture barrier and sometimes adding a dehumidifier.
Additional Repairs - Costs for repairs such as foundation crack sealing or sump pump installation typically range from $500 to $2,500. These are often necessary components of comprehensive waterproofing projects.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
